Job title: Director of External Relations and Brand Strategy (part influencer, part marketing expert, part relationship builder)

Business Unit: Administrative Team

Hiring Pay range: $106,127- $122,046 DOE

Job Type: Full-time; benefitted, exempt

  • You have 7+ years of brand strategy/marketing/communications experience, and at least 3 years managing a team of employees
  • You have a bachelor's degree in marketing, communications, business, or related field.
  • You have been an integral part of a business, library, or nonprofit organization's success story in diverse communities.
  • You have demonstrated success creating and executing integrated brand, marketing and communications strategies on a national or global scale.
  • You possess outstanding storytelling and creative skills-you are able to distill complex ideas into compelling narratives for diverse audiences.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ills are required, with the 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ously, prioritize effectively, adapt to changing priorities, and meet deadlines in a high-speed environment.
  • You are tech-savvy. You are computer literate, and possess a working knowledge of Microsoft Office suite, as well as searching and navigating online resources.
  • You have reputation management and crisis communication experience.
  • Your work style demonstrates high emotional intelligence and cultural competency.
  • Spanish speaking candidates desired.
